Mastering A-site executions in tactical gameplay requires a combination of strategy, utility management, and teamwork. One of the essential strategies is to utilize an effective smoking technique to block enemy vision. This often involves the use of smoke grenades to obscure key sightlines, allowing your team to advance safely. Additionally, coordinating with your teammates to throw flashes or molotovs can disorient defenders, providing a clear path for the assault. For optimal results, consider creating a pre-attack plan that outlines utility usage and roles for each player, ensuring everyone understands their responsibilities during the execution.
Once you've meticulously planned your approach, the next step is mastering utility usage within the A-site. Utilize explosive devices strategically by tossing grenades into common hiding spots to flush out enemies or set up crossfires. It's crucial to remember that timing is everything; deploying your utilities in harmony with your team's movement can catch enemy defenders off-guard. To enhance your effectiveness, practice specific utility lineups that guarantee consistency and precision. Over time, this will significantly improve your team's ability to execute A-site strategies successfully and dominate the competition.

Executing a flawless bombsite takeover requires precision, teamwork, and an understanding of your opponents' movements. Pro players emphasize the importance of strategic planning before a match begins. To start, communicate effectively with your team to devise an attack plan. Consider utilizing a smoke grenade to obscure the enemies' vision, which allows your team to maneuver closer to the bombsite without being detected. After deploying the smoke, follow up with a coordinated flashbang to disorient opponents, allowing for a safer entry.
Another crucial aspect of a successful bombsite takeover is the element of surprise. Pro players often recommend varying your approach to keep opponents guessing. For instance, alternate your bombsite fakes with actual assaults—this forces your enemies to spread themselves thin. Once you initiate the takeover, make sure to watch the flanks and utilize sound cues to track enemy movements. Remember, maintaining positional awareness during the engagement is key; if you're unsure of the enemy's locations, always leap back to safety and regroup with your team for a renewed assault.
When executing a bombsite in CSGO, one of the most common mistakes players make is failing to communicate effectively with their team. Coordination is crucial, and without it, your team can end up disorganized and vulnerable. Always use voice chat or in-game commands to relay information regarding your position, enemy sightings, and when you're ready to push. This ensures that everyone is on the same page and can initiate the attack at the right moment. Additionally, neglecting to utilize utility grenades before entering a site can lead to disastrous outcomes; if these tools are not employed properly, you risk facing opposition without the advantage of cover or disruption.
Another frequent error is rushing into a bombsite without proper setup. It's vital to always perform a scout before committing to a site; failing to assess the enemy's positioning can easily result in your team being heavily outnumbered. Players should also be wary of overcommitting to a bombsite when the attacking strategy becomes compromised. If your initial push encounters unexpected resistance, regrouping and adapting your strategy is essential rather than pressing on blindly. Lastly, not covering each other’s flanks can lead to easy eliminations for the defending team. Always remember to watch each other's backs, especially when planting the bomb.
